Call for Articles: SkulTech Journal of Education Science & Technology (SJEST)
Unlocking the Future of Learning Through Research
The SkulTech Journal of Education Science & Technology (SJEST) is delighted to announce its continuous Call for Articles for upcoming issues. As an international, peer-reviewed, and open-access scholarly journal, SJEST is dedicated to publishing high-quality, original research that sits at the dynamic intersection of education, science, and technology.
We invite researchers, academics, practitioners, and policymakers from around the globe to submit their cutting-edge work that contributes significantly to the theoretical understanding and practical application within these critical fields.
Our Focus and Scope
SJEST is committed to bridging the gap between theory and practice by disseminating rigorous research that informs effective educational policies and practices. We seek contributions that explore the multifaceted relationships between education, scientific advancements, and technological innovations.
Topics of interest include, but are not limited to:
- Educational Technology: AI in education, virtual and augmented reality in learning, e-learning methodologies, digital literacy, educational software design, online learning environments, and technology integration strategies.
- Pedagogical Research: Innovative teaching and learning approaches, curriculum development, assessment strategies, educational psychology, inclusive education practices, and STEM pedagogy.
- Science Education: Effective methods for teaching science disciplines, laboratory innovations, and the role of technology in scientific inquiry and understanding.
- Technology Education: Development of technological literacy, vocational training, and the societal implications of emerging technologies.
- Interdisciplinary Studies: Research exploring the synergies between education, science, technology, and other fields like sociology, economics, and public policy.
- Policy and Practice: Analysis of educational reforms, policy impacts of technological advancements, and the implementation of new educational initiatives.
